Questcor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(NASDAQ: QCOR) shares closed up 18% on Monday and also hit a new yearly high of $89.30 during intra-day trading. Mallinckrodt is buying the California-based company for a combination of stock and cash valued at about $5.6 billion. Mallinckrodt makes a range of specialty pharmaceuticals. Questcor's primary product is H.P. Acthar Gel, which is used in the management of autoimmune and inflammatory conditions. It is approved in the U.S. for treating 19 indications.

Questcor Pharmaceuticals, Inc., a biopharmaceutical company, provides drugs for the treatment of autoimmune and inflammatory disorders. The company primarily offers H.P. Acthar Gel, an injectable drug to induce a diuresis or a remission of proteinuria in the nephrotic syndrome without uremia of the idiopathic type or that due to lupus erythematosus; as exacerbation or maintenance therapy in various cases of systemic lupus erythematosus and systemic dermatomyositis; and as adjunctive therapy for short-term administration in psoriatic arthritis, rheumatoid arthritis, and ankylosing spondylitis. Its H.P. Acthar Gel is also used for the treatment of acute exacerbations of multiple sclerosis in adults; and as monotherapy for the treatment of infantile spasms in infants and children under two years of age.

The Procter & Gamble Company (NYSE: PG) has increased its quarterly dividend 7% to 64.36 cents a share from 60.15 cents a share Monday. The quarterly dividend is payable on May 15 to all shareholders of record as of the close of business on April 25. The ex-dividend date is set for April 22. The Procter & Gamble Co. has paid a quarterly dividend since the company was incorporated in 1890.

The Procter & Gamble Company,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and sells branded consumer packaged goods. The company operates through five segments: Beauty, Grooming, Health Care, Fabric Care and Home Care, and Baby Care and Family Care. The Beauty segment offers antiperspirants and deodorants, cosmetics, personal cleansing, skin care, hair care, hair colors, prestige products, and professional salon products under the Head & Shoulders, Olay, Pantene, SK-II, and Wella brand names. The Grooming segment provides blades and razors, pre- and post-shave products, and electronic hair removal devices under the Braun, Fusion, Gillette, Mach3, and Prestobarba brand names.
